Key Features of a Long-Lasting Pruning Shear
Before you choose a specific brand, it helps to know what makes a pruner last. The most critical component is the blade material. Stainless steel is an excellent choice for most homeowners because its composition naturally resists rust and corrosion, which is a huge advantage if you occasionally forget to wipe your tools down or live in a humid climate. While carbon steel can hold a slightly sharper edge, it requires diligent cleaning and oiling to prevent rust, a maintenance step many busy people prefer to skip.
Next, consider the handle and cutting mechanism. Ergonomic handles with non-slip grips reduce hand fatigue, a crucial feature for anyone with a lot of pruning to do or for those who experience hand strain or arthritis. The cutting action is also key. Bypass pruners, which operate like a pair of scissors with one blade "bypassing" the other, make clean cuts on living stems and branches, which is essential for plant health. Look for a strong spring mechanism that opens the blades smoothly after each cut and a secure, easy-to-operate safety lock.
Fiskars Steel Bypass Pruner for All-Purpose Use
If you need one reliable tool for 90% of the jobs around your yard, the classic Fiskars bypass pruner is a fantastic starting point. This is the workhorse you’ll grab to trim back overgrown rose bushes, deadhead perennials, or shape small shrubs. It’s designed for homeowners and renters who need a dependable tool that works well without a lot of fuss or a high price tag.
Its strength lies in its simplicity and durable construction. The fully hardened, precision-ground steel blade maintains its sharpness through heavy use, and a low-friction coating helps it glide through branches up to 5/8-inch thick. This coating also prevents sap and debris from sticking, which is a primary contributor to rust and corrosion. For general-purpose garden maintenance, this pruner offers an exceptional balance of performance, durability, and value.

Saboten 1210 for Angled, Effortless Cutting
Sometimes, the most significant innovations are simple ergonomic adjustments. The Saboten 1210 pruner is a perfect example, featuring an angled cutting head that sets it apart. This design is for anyone who finds that traditional straight-headed pruners cause wrist strain during long pruning sessions.
By angling the blades, the tool allows your hand and wrist to remain in a more neutral, comfortable position while you cut. This small change can dramatically reduce fatigue and the risk of repetitive strain injury. The pruner is typically constructed with high-quality Japanese stainless steel, known for holding a very sharp edge, and a simple, durable locking mechanism. It’s an excellent choice for gardeners who prioritize ergonomic comfort and efficient, clean cuts.
Fiskars Micro-Tip Snips for Delicate Plant Care
For the dedicated "plant parent" or meticulous flower gardener, some tasks require surgical precision. The Fiskars Micro-Tip Snips are designed for the most delicate jobs, like shaping orchids, trimming air plants, or snipping spent blossoms from annuals without disturbing new buds. This is the tool for when a standard pruner is simply too clumsy.
These snips feature sharp, stainless steel blades with a non-stick coating and an ultra-fine point for making precise cuts in tight spaces. The hallmark is the Easy Action™ spring, which gently opens the blades after every cut to prevent hand strain during repetitive tasks. It’s crucial to use this tool as intended. Its fine tips are not designed for woody stems or anything over 1/4-inch in diameter; using it on tough material will quickly ruin its alignment and sharpness. For its specific purpose, however, it is an invaluable tool.
